Could we see new Babylon 5 music from Chris Franke in the next year? He is scoring the soundtrack for the new direct–to–DVD release Babylon 5: The Lost Tales, and I'm sure he'll do his usual amazing job. Here's hoping that some kind of soundtrack will be made available after the release!

After four years offline, The Music of Babylon 5 has been resurrected. Thanks to the webmaster of FirstOnes.com and his project to restore lost Babylon 5 fan sites to the Web, he got me excited to bring back my own site.

Back in 2002, amidst my studies and my full-time job, I found myself coming home each night wanting to crash and sleep rather than fire up the Mac and work on my web sites. Making these mixes takes some time, and I was quickly becoming less willing to make the time. Also, the cost of my server back then wasn't chicken feed. These two factors are the reasons why I decided to close the site. But now, four years later, I have figured out how to deal with busy schedules better. Most significant, though, is the ability to run the site for free thanks to the FirstOnes.com archive project!

Despite the redesign, most of this site is what you remember from years back, but I will also start updating it again. The remaining music that hasn't been featured on this site is precious little since Sonic Images hasn't released any new soundtracks since my site went offline. However, I will still maintain the site and update it periodically with new mixes and musical projects.

Thanks to technology advancing over the last several years, especially internet speeds and audio software, a lot of the music on this site has been re-tooled. Any mixes that were two–parters before have been stiched back together to become one track. The audio quality of the new mixes will be a lot better (less distortion from compression) thanks to Apple's amazing suite of audio software. All the tracks here are optimized for iTunes but are still in MP3 format for use in your preferred player.

There are several new mixes this month in addition to the Featured Mix, The Face Of The Enemy. All the old mixes that were 2–parters have been remixed so that they are now just a single track. Most have been remixed from scratch, so there is some new music in almost all of them. Check out the whopping 44–minute long Thirdspace mix!
